Viski commented on 2020-03-20 05:35 (UTC) (edited on 2020-03-20 05:37 (UTC) by Viski)
In addition to the already reported missing dependency to fuse2
, pcloud seems to also have a dependency for libxss
:
$ pcloud
pcloud: error while loading shared libraries: libXss.so.1: cannot open shared object file: No such file or directory
Installing libxss
solved the issue of course.

rew1red commented on 2020-01-16 15:53 (UTC)
I'm seeing issues on 5.4.11-arch1-1 with only fuse3 (3.9.0-1) installed. It appears that pcloud-drive (1.7.2-1) is still seeking fuse2 when it starts up:
A JavaScript error occurred in the main process
Uncaught Exception:
Error: ENOENT: no such file or directory, open 'libfuse.so.2'
at Object.fs.openSync (fs.js:577:3)
...
In my case, explicitly installing fuse2 does resolve this, but what I've found would indicate the dependency chain is broken.
